Get more Puppy Love from Pet House DS

July 19th, 2007 ThreeHeadedMonkey Posted in DS | Comment »

If Nintendogs whetted your appetite for all things canine, you might want to check out Pet House DS. The new digital doggy simulator lets you choose from 47 breeds, including Poodles, Siberian Huskies, Dachshunds and Chihuahua. Donkey Kong Coin Catcher

July 18th, 2007 ThreeHeadedMonkey Posted in Japan | Comment »

We found this great coin catcher in Osaka’s Namco City arcade. Donkey Kong Banana Beat features a coin dropper with swinging bananas sweeping the coins left and right, making it a bit more challenging than usual.
